程序员喜欢什么样的产品经理?

author author     2022-08-19     643

关键词:

  程序员和产品经理协作、沟通矛盾是一个永恒的话题。因为两者的知识体系和思维结构不一样,关注的重点不一样,所以在协同工作过程中,难免会出现一些分歧和摩擦,出现互相埋怨和吐槽的情况。

  我认为,程序员和产品经理之间的健康关系应该是基于信任、尊重和理解以及同一利益共同体的,脱离了这一前提,高效的协作就成了空谈。

  那产品经理在日常的工作过程中,与程序员要保持高度默契,形成健康的协作关系,需要注意哪些方面呢?今天结合我曾经在两个角色之间完成过转换的经历,谈谈自己的理解,一家之言,欢迎拍砖。

  一、平等、尊重与理解是第一前提。

  首先,产品经理应该明确知晓项目/团队的目标,与程序员是同一利益共同体,所有的讨论、分歧、摩擦、思想碰撞都是对事不对人的,也不存在必然的领导和被领导、上级和下级的关系。产品经理跟程序员之间是平等的协作关系,双方的命运与产品息息相关。有时候程序员对产品倾注的情感,付出的努力,并不比产品经理少;程序员对产品的期望和思考,也不比产品经理低,有时候甚至高于产品经理。

  举个例子,大部分的产品经理在设计新房时可能考虑了电梯、逃生通道、水电、电器接入,但程序员想得会更多,他们会关注停电停水之后房间里需不需要备蜡烛、紧急照明灯以及储备用水。

  程序员是产品/项目的实际实施者和创造者,产品经理是帮助产品创造的设计者和连接者,是团队中的一员,而不是突出的个人。放弃你改变世界的想法,以平等、尊重彼此的心态,和程序员们做朋友、做队友。

  二、不打扰,多给程序员时间和空间。

  程序员非常讨厌的一点(即使你做了,可能他们也不会明说)是当他思维在高度集中、效率奇高构建思维、飞快码字的时候,产品经理不断地跑过来说一些无关痛痒的“点”打断他的思维。

  是的,断了的思维有时候会延续不上,甚至有时候会让产品实现逻辑上少掉一个关键的分支。不用在产品实现的时候频繁出现刷存在感,当他(程序员)需要你的时候,他会自己找你。即便你自己发现了产品问题或者bug,如果不是核心的、致命的问题,请先记在一个列表里,集中给他。

  产品经理要学会在大多数时候,让程序员忘了你的存在,但在最需要你的时候你才挺身而出。

  友情提醒:下午3点开始到晚上,是程序员思维活跃、工作较为高效的时间段。

  三、有担当,敢担当,不贪功。

  所有产品经理都绕不过去的一个坎是“老板需求”。什么是老板需求?说白了就是:老板需要一个这样的东西,老板想要这样做。但老板不接触程序员,他接触产品经理。如果你只是老板需求的转发者,而不是产品需求的过滤者、把关者,可能会被视为“无担当”。

  老板需求跟用户需求、产品基础需求应该是平等的,也有合理、不合理之分,也有优先级。当产品经理发现老板需求不是太合理时,产品经理要冒着丢掉饭碗的风险与老板据理力争,动之以理,晓之以情。

  曾经有一次老板提了一个几乎是颠覆当前产品架构以及技术架构设计的想法,他觉得非常重要,必须要尽快实现。我认为当前产品第一要务是解决基础功能问题,打好产品根基。跟他PK的时候双方情绪激动,就差没有拍桌子,老板在途中也说了一句,”我觉得你非常聪明,也非常适合做产品经理,但是你有点固执,你看得没我清楚”,但最后证明产品根基对于产品的可持续发展是非常重要的,也给产品后续的迭代提供了非常好的基础。

  一日三省吾身,产品经理的工作性质决定了产品经理是容易犯错的。一旦产品的设计上出了问题,作为产品的决策者,你不能把责任往外推,要有承担责任的态度和表率。但对于有价值的产品方向近乎固执的坚持,不轻易推翻、变更需求,是产品经理敢担当、有担当的表现,则是最程序员劳动最基本的尊重。

  产品设计/实现出现问题时,担当而不推诿;需要资源支持时,巧取而不豪夺(这里的“豪夺”是指动不动搬上下级关系施压);在产品有成绩和突破时,表达而不贪功。

  在协作、磨合过程中,有担当,敢担当,不贪功,善良比聪明更重要。

  四、点到即止,不越俎代庖。

  许多产品经理喜欢想当然,特别是技术出身的产品经理,很难去把握点到即止的度,经常说“这个应该很简单吧”、“这个应该这样去实现”,更有甚至在聊需求的时候会深入聊到技术上如何去实现。

  懂点技术有利于在跟程序员沟通的时候换位思考,评估需求落地风险,但又很容易让产品经理越俎代庖,对技术实现方案过多介入。

  在提需求之前先跟程序员有线下沟通能够提升你的需求合理度和风险控制能力,但不要讨论技术实现细节。技术是程序员们所擅长的东西,信任他们,你要做的就是,倾听、欣赏他们的方案,不推翻,只提建议。

  五、多陪陪他们。

  程序员大多需要在工作时间参与产品需求评审、产品沟通,留给他们写代码的时间并不是太多,所以晚上经常加班。产品经理的工作并不仅限于需求设计、文档撰写,还有一块很重要的工作是“需求实现顾问”。当产品需求进入研发阶段,并不意味着产品经理的事就没有了。当程序员在实现产品需求时,不断会有一些问题需要产品经理确认。当他需要你的时候,你最好能出现在他身边。

  说白了,就是“多陪程序员加班”。多跟他们相处,一起吃饭,偶尔请他们吃个加班夜宵,多体会他们工作环境和状态,一起思考,你提的拍脑袋的需求就会越来越少,合理需求越来越多。

  常说,无招胜有招,产品经理能做到淡化角色,适时出现在合适的位置,便是极好。

  产品经理不是光鲜亮丽的角色,也只是团队中的一员,跟大家荣辱与共,同享成败。所以,你们互相承担彼此变化带来的后果,你们是同事、是队友、更是朋友。

  (文章来源码农网)

产品经理四大层级,你处于什么位置?

...层理解和主流观点或许不符,却正因这点,才让我从心底喜欢这件事。欢迎产品旺来拍砖讨论。 第一层级 查看详情

产品程序员如何和产品经理沟通01——产品经理的能力模型

简介 作为一只从技术转向产品的程序猿,和大家分享一下产品经理的一些要素。一方面给各位程序猿参考一下,所谓知己知彼,方便以后和产品汪们优雅地撕逼;另一方面,如果有想从技术转产品的程序猿也可以作为参考。... 查看详情

聊聊后台产品经理

...,一是出于自己是研发出身,相对于页面体验和交互,更喜欢逻辑、数据和结构,另一个是我对前后端产品的定义了解之后,认为后台产品才是一个产品的灵魂所在,前台更像一张皮,负责吸引用户,后台是一个产品真正的思维... 查看详情

0基础转产品经理day01

...ff1f;我做这个岗位的优势有哪些?我希望自己的工作环境是什么样的?”,我们只有经过这种理性的思考,才能最终选对我们的职 查看详情

什么是产品经理

什么是产品经理一、互联网产品生命周期与团队角色二、产品经理的定义能够独当一面做好让用户满意的产品的人三、产品经理的职责负责“所有”产品相关的事但通常不都是亲力亲为四、产品经理的核心工作决定什么是&... 查看详情

一分钟内让你理解什么是产品经理?

...某论坛上看见一个段子,生动形象地描绘出了产品经理、程序员、需求者三者之间那无以言表的关系图。看完这个段子也深刻体会到今年刚上线的大大神平台责任重大,该平台主要以产品经理为特色推出,平台又要怎样为三者之... 查看详情

究竟什么是产品经理

产品经理究竟是一个如何职位呢?他的主要职责是什么?一个刚入行的产品经理。甚至一个资深产品经理或多或少对该职位都会有某种迷惑。资深产品经理、在线投资管理公司Covestor的首席产品官MartinEriksson发表了一篇文章《What,... 查看详情

为什么猝死的都是程序员,基本上不见产品经理猝死呢?

...文章三部曲,点赞,评论,转发。微信搜索【程序员小安】关注还在移动开发领域苟活的大龄程序员,移动开发“面试系列”文章将在公众号发布。相信大家时不时听到程序员猝死的消息,但是基本上听不到... 查看详情

产品经理具体是做什么的?

 什么是产品经理?产品经理,是企业中专门负责产品管理的职位,产品经理负责市场调查并根据用户的需求,确定开发何种产品,选择何种技术、商业模式等。并推动相应产品的开发组织,他还要根据产品的生命周期,协调... 查看详情

资深pm告诉你为什么产品经理应该学习代码编程

大家都说产品经理不需要懂太多编程技术,不用太刻意学习编程知识,真的是这样么?今天和大家分享的是产品经理应该学习代码编程,为什么呢?一起来看看吧。对于一个产品汪来说,创造产品是一件令人兴奋的事情(程序喵... 查看详情

程序员可以转产品经理吗

程序员可以转产品经理吗  产品经理跟程序员是不一样的,产品经理只需要懂一点,不需要多厉害,应届生都是可以当产品经理的。而程序员强调编程技能,专业技术,语言功底,懂不懂操作系统这些;产品经理强调沟通... 查看详情

产品经理和项目经理到底有什么区别?

...还得忙着和项目经理撕逼……当产品经理与上项目经理,什么样的方式才是正确的打开方式? 在很多时候,互联网公司的产品经理还需要兼任一部分项目经理的角色,需要整体把控项目的启动、计划、执行和监控、以及项目收... 查看详情

从程序员到产品经理

一直以来我都觉得自己是个典型性程序员。比如出门时候我总是穿格子衫、牛仔裤,戴着黑框眼镜背个双肩包;比如休闲时候我是个死宅,喜欢玩游戏和看小说;比如一直到23岁时候我依然是“妹手软”,没谈... 查看详情

优秀的产品经理应该具备什么样的文案能力?

当今时代,很多互联网公司的 产品经理 越来越像个多面手,除了必须做好一个UE 设计师和项目跟进者外,还要做产品迭代规划设计、市场需求、商务需求、用户需求。  一个合格的产品经理应该做到4个了解... 查看详情

面试产品经理时如何回答“为什么想做产品经理”这个问题

面试时很多问题是相通的:为什么想做产品经理=为什么你适合做产品经理=你做产品经理的优势是什么当问出“为什么想做产品经理/为什么转行做产品经理”时,面试官的动机,是想知道:我为什么要录用... 查看详情

黑衣路人:程序员可以转行做产品经理吗?

5年前,我还是一位Java开发的程序员和PHP的开发人员,有着同学中还算可以的技术基础,然而后来我却去了网易找了份运营的实习,并且现在成了一名-1岁的产品经理。很多朋友其实对我的转变并不是很理解。于是他们问我:“... 查看详情

“有一个产品经理的女朋友是什么体验?”

源自/画漫画的程序员话说王大拿最近工作特别积极每天下班后都待在公司为老板能经常换跑车尽心尽力做一名合格的螺丝钉…其实这背后的苦楚,只有他自己懂…上次被产品老妈催婚后吓的都不敢回家了毕竟别的单身狗回去... 查看详情

如何回答「为什么想做产品经理」面试核心问题3

当问出“为什么想做产品经理/为什么转行做产品经理”时,面试官的动机,是想知道:我为什么要录用你做产品经理今日问题:为什么想做产品经理面试时很多问题是相通的:为什么想做产品经理=为什么... 查看详情